Using older 3DConnexion devices in SW2008
Using older 3DConnexion devices in SW2008
(OP)
When I installed SW2008 at home, my Cadman 3d controller stopped working - SW2008 ended up blocking a DLL file that was too old.
There is a work around that worked for me. (This is not endorsed by 3DConnexion, but I do not feel like laying out 100's of dollars for a new device for home.)
Here's what to do: Install the(old) driver file for the device, but not the SW plugin. In my case the device driver is 2.8.2. If the SW plugin is installed, uninstall it from the control panel. Then download the current device driver, say 3.5.5 and unpack it with Winrar. Install the SW plugin only.
Cadman works perfectly in SW2008. I've read online that this works on serial devices too. My Cadman is USB.
